World Cup Fever

Football mania came to KSA when the Primary Phase held a World Cup Parade.

The celebration, which was attended by parents, kicked off with an Indian-inspired theme by Year 5. 
Next followed Year 4 with their Australian theme complete with cork hats.  Year 3 represented Brazil with their Mardi Gras parade complete with a lion and peacock float. 
Year 2 was the host country - South Africa - with South African-inspired dresses and tunics.  Year 1 performed a cheerleading routine inspired by the USA, while Reception paraded doing the Can-Can. 
Last but by no means least, was the Nursery's parade complete with handkerchiefs on their heads to represent England.  To finish the show Year 6 sang the World Cup anthem 'Wavin Flag'.
Year 3 Teacher Melissa Warman said: "Thank you to all who supported the children by coming to watch - only four more years until the next one."
